Cost-Effectiveness Comparison



When comparing the cost-effectiveness of solar energy with standard energy sources, it comes to be noticeable that initial investment differences play a critical function in figuring out long-lasting savings.

While solar power systems require a greater ahead of time investment for installation and tools, they supply substantial long-lasting advantages that can surpass the initial expenses. The crucial depend on understanding that solar energy systems have very little ongoing functional and maintenance costs compared to traditional energy sources like nonrenewable fuel sources.

By investing in solar power, you can potentially save on utility costs over the system's life expectancy. In addition, with developments in technology and reducing setup costs, solar energy has actually become more accessible and budget friendly for property owners and companies alike. These savings can accumulate with time, providing a return on investment that surpasses traditional power sources.



Moreover, solar power systems use the advantage of energy freedom and security versus rising and fall utility rates. By utilizing the power of the sun, you contribute to a cleaner setting and decrease your carbon footprint. Embracing solar power not only advantages your budget however also the planet over time.

Environmental Impact Analysis



Solar energy provides a promising option to traditional power resources as a result of its considerably reduced environmental effect. Unlike fossil fuels that produce unsafe greenhouse gases and add to air contamination, solar power creates power without producing any type of discharges.

The procedure of utilizing solar energy includes catching sunshine with photovoltaic panels, which does not launch any contaminants into the environment. This absence of emissions helps in reducing the carbon impact associated with power production, making solar power a cleaner and extra lasting alternative.

Additionally, making use of solar power contributes to preservation initiatives by reducing the demand for finite sources like coal, oil, and natural gas. By counting on the sunlight's abundant and renewable resource resource, we can help maintain all-natural environments, safeguard communities, and reduce the negative effects of resource extraction.
